Design and Aesthetics

The Logitech Pebble Mouse 2 M350s features a minimalist round design that is both slim and lightweight, making it highly portable. Its multiple colours allow users to express their personality, which may appeal to those who prioritise aesthetics. In contrast, the TECKNET Wireless Mouse has a more traditional ergonomic design, specifically tailored for right-handed users. With its streamlined arc and finger rest, it focuses on comfort and prolonged usage rather than style. While the Logitech mouse leans towards a modern look, the TECKNET prioritises functionality and comfort, catering to a different segment of users.

Functionality and Features

The Logitech Pebble Mouse 2 M350s stands out with its ability to connect to up to three devices across various operating systems, including Windows, macOS, and ChromeOS. This feature is ideal for users who frequently switch between devices. Meanwhile, the TECKNET Wireless Mouse offers six DPI levels (from 800 to 4800) that allow users to adjust the cursor sensitivity based on their activity, enhancing productivity. Additionally, it features side buttons for page navigation. While both mice have their strengths, the Logitech's multi-device support may be more beneficial for users with diverse tech ecosystems.

Battery Life and Power Management

The TECKNET Wireless Mouse is powered by two AA batteries, which are not included, while the Logitech Pebble Mouse 2 M350s boasts an impressive battery life of up to two years, with an auto-sleep mode that conserves power. This could mean less frequent battery replacements and hassle for Logitech users. Given that the TECKNET mouse does not specify a battery life, it could potentially result in a less convenient experience over time. Users prioritising long-lasting performance may lean towards the Logitech model due to its more reliable battery management features.

Noise Levels and Usage Environment

One of the key selling points of the Logitech Pebble Mouse 2 M350s is its Silent Touch Technology, which reduces click noise by up to 90%. This feature is particularly beneficial for those working in quiet environments or shared spaces, allowing for discreet usage without disturbing others. In contrast, the TECKNET Wireless Mouse does not mention any noise reduction features, which could lead to a noisier experience. For users who value a quiet workspace, the Logitech model provides a significant advantage.

Compatibility with Devices

The TECKNET Wireless Mouse is compatible with a wide range of operating systems, including Windows (from 2000 to 11), Mac, and various others, making it a versatile choice for diverse users. However, the side buttons of the TECKNET mouse are not functional on Mac systems. On the other hand, the Logitech Pebble Mouse 2 M350s can seamlessly connect with three devices across multiple OSs, enhancing its usability across various platforms. This flexibility may make the Logitech model more appealing for users who operate multiple devices, while the TECKNET mouse is a solid choice for those who primarily use Windows.

User Experience and Comfort

The TECKNET Wireless Mouse is designed with ergonomics in mind, featuring a finger rest and a shape that reduces strain during prolonged use. This makes it a suitable option for individuals who spend long hours at their computers. The Logitech Pebble Mouse 2 M350s, while also user-friendly, focuses more on portability and aesthetics than extended comfort. Users who prioritise ergonomic design for long-term use may find the TECKNET mouse to be a better fit, while those who value style and compactness might prefer the Logitech option.
